Output 034135df169cc61e345fd9a0970d5086d41f0fdc4cc3531039208c6312b64914:21

value
105862
script pubkey
OP_0 OP_PUSHBYTES_20 57b284bfdbc425e6e7b5a81fde83f8058c72f992
address
bc1q27egf07mcsj7dea44q0aaqlcqkx897vjf47xpf
transaction
034135df169cc61e345fd9a0970d5086d41f0fdc4cc3531039208c6312b64914
spent
true